When you buy soccer cleats, make sure they fit properly. They need to fit snugly and need to support your arches as well. The cleats must also allow free movement of your ankles. Remember, purchasing poorly fitting cleats can really hurt your feet, so choose carefully.
The Outside Elastico is a basic move to master. This is a trick that can help you get inside when you’re dealing in the flanks. To master the move, get a cone or another object, and set it upon the ground. Start five steps away from the cone. Start to dribble towards it. As you get closer to the cone, tap the ball outside then tap it in quick motion back to the inner part. Making outside touches tricks your opponents, allowing you to get by them. Keep in mind that your second touch needs to be bigger then your first one.
Fool your defenders by dribbling in the opposing direction you are seeking to go. Lead the defender away and then quickly cut back in your intended direction. As a result, you can effectively evade your defenders and head towards the goal.

If you want to increase your stamina, do long distance runs during the off season. Typically, a soccer player runs for about eight miles per game. By running a lot, you can have increased stamina so you’re able to play soccer better without taking as many breaks.

Kick the ball the right way. Keep in mind that the process of kicking the ball involves more than simply kicking. Kick the bottom of a soccer ball in order to send it into the air. Your foot should be utilized like a wedge so you can get underneath the ball and try to kick it up while you lean backwards.
You need to triangulate if you wish to get through rock solid defenses. Move quickly to pass the ball to teammates, this creates confusion and can give your team an opportunity to score. This passing can effectively break down a tight defense. Be ready to help your teammate and vice-verse.
